Output def0aa99d17f7726b60eb79a4e1849e4e10a0f37c01b632398ef2076874d4427:14

value
161093403
script pubkey
OP_0 OP_PUSHBYTES_20 89e5b93546227120d63e29795903d2652ad15830
address
bc1q38jmjd2xyfcjp43799u4jq7jv54dzkpspy9w62
transaction
def0aa99d17f7726b60eb79a4e1849e4e10a0f37c01b632398ef2076874d4427
spent
true